长期以来,我国铁路客票的发售一直沿用人工作业方式,劳动强度大,售票速度慢,售票范围受局限。旅客购票要排长队,“购票难”的问题已经成了费时费力的社会问题。与铁路购票相比,机票的预订采用网上订票系统就显得方便多了。
随着京沪高铁的开通,铁道部推出了一系列便民的新举措,在年底前逐步推开网络售票,积极推广电子客票、银行卡购票、自动售检票等。这就需要网上订票系统来取代老式的售票方式,以满足当今网络社会的需求。
网上订票系统整体架构
网上定票系统设计网站订票、票点、厂商以及后台管理等多个子系统,其架构设计与目前国内普遍采用的系统架构有着很大的区别。系统的参与方包括订票人、铁路车站和银行等单位。需要用到的原始数据库包括车票数据库、银行数据库;在处理问题的过程中要创建的数据库有注册成员数据库、交易历史记录数据库、冻结资金数据库等。
系统从整体上分为前台应用和后台服务两部分。前台应用软件由网上订票软件、资金支付软件和终端售票软件、终端管理监控软件组成。后台服务软件完成主要的应用逻辑处理和系统运行维护等复杂交易处理工作。
网上订票系统分析
对网上订票的流程进行详细调查之后,得出其业务流程如下:
(1)用户注册个人信息,从而在系统中可以订票。
(2)用户通过系统查询车次信息,然后选择出行的车次。
(3)用户在订票界面选择车票信息以及送票方式等相关信息。
(4)管理员查看车票剩余信息,如果有车票打电话通知用户,确认用户是否订购车票以及费用,如果订票则在系统中确定。
(5)用户通过支付手段支付费用后,通知客服。
(6)客服根据订单的送票方式,根据客户的地址,送票。
网上订票系统设计
根据系统功能要求分析,网上订票系统总共由三大功能模块组成,包括车次查询模块、系统管理模块、用户模块。根据实际需求设计订票系统的功能,实现了网上订票的方便性、快捷性、完善性,并划分系统的逻辑功能模块。火车票的购买途径主要有车站购买,代售点出售等形式,购买的地方以及时间受到限制,不能给乘客带来便利。列车时刻表十分的复杂,即便是买上一本列车时刻表,也十分不方便查询自己的乘车路线,而且由于列车时刻的变动性,所以购买不是十分的方便,因此系统要满足以下需求:
(1)乘客输入车次或出行的出发站与终点站,可查询车次信息,从而选择自己的乘车区间以及车次。
(2)选择取票方式(包括票点取票、货到收款),建立订单管理模块。
(3)通过简单查询和复杂查询来察看服务相关信息。管理员对用户角色设置以及角色的添加与修改。
(4)新闻信息的管理,添加,删除,修改。
(5)对用户订票信息的办理。
转发请注明:丁丁猫